---+ .TEXT SET FONT INDEX _This subroutine sets the font index for the "current" text object._ <br />%TOC% ---++ Usage: <pre> PASS <font_index> FIELD SHARE? N PASS <font_no> FIELD SHARE? N GOSUB 0CD .TEXT SET FONT INDEX * Check for error IF 0CD .TEXT SET FONT INDEX NE </pre> ---++ Description: This subroutine sets the font index for "current" text object. This is only required if the font you have chosen for the title is a font family that contains multiple fonts. The font index you pass here tells Chart Director which font within the family it should use. <font_index> refers to the index of a font within the font family. If blank or not passed, index 0 will be used. Must be in the range 1 to 9. <font_no> refers to the which of the three possible fonts the index applies to. If blank or not passed, font number 1 will be used. Must be in the range 1 to 3. See FontSpecifications for more information on setting fonts and font numbers. ---++ Comments: _Read what other users have said about this page or add your own comments._ <br />%COMMENT% -- Main.JeanNeron - 2011-11-17
